oldspicelong Posted August 29, 2009 Share Posted August 29, 2009 ok i know how to display data for a user who is logged in but how want to make it so other people can view another person info. I want to display all the user names from the database using php and then when a user clicks on the users name it displays that users information Link to comment https://forums.phpfreaks.com/topic/172420-displaying-data-from-a-database/ Share on other sites More sharing options...
oldspicelong Posted August 29, 2009 Author Share Posted August 29, 2009 iv worked on the script myself this is all i have done of it so far <?php session_start(); if(!isset($_GET['user'])) { echo "You have not selected a user to fight!<br><br>"; $NPCS = mysql_query("SELECT * FROM `users` "); while($Show = mysql_fetch_array($NPCS)) { echo "<a href=\"profileviewer.php? Action=view&user=" . $Show['username'] . "\">" . $Show['username'] . "</a><br>"; } exit(); } $NPC = mysql_escape_string($_GET['user']); $username = $_COOKIE['ID_my_site']; if($_GET[Action] = view) { if($username == $NPC){echo "You cannot fight yourself! <br><br>"; exit();} $UserS = mysql_query("SELECT * FROM `users` WHERE username='$username'"); $UserS = mysql_fetch_array($UserS); $UserH = $UserS['health']; echo "Name:".$UserS['username']."<br/>"; ?> Link to comment https://forums.phpfreaks.com/topic/172420-displaying-data-from-a-database/#findComment-909072 Share on other sites More sharing options...
Recommended Posts
Archived
This topic is now archived and is closed to further replies.